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kintbury to Horwich Parkway start from as little as £40.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Kintbury to Horwich Parkway start from £93.20 one way, or £128.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kintbury to Horwich Parkway are available for £137.80 one way, or £275.50 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Although small, Kintbury station is equipped with essentials for your journey. While there is no ticket office, you can find ticket machines to purchase or collect pre-booked rail tickets. Being accommodating, the station ensures accessible machines and an induction loop, making it user-friendly for all. Although there aren’t any smartcard facilities, the traditional ticketing system is straightforward and reliable.

Kintbury Station extends a helping hand via customer support available at help points. However, it's worth noting that hands-on staff assistance over the weekends is sparse. You can readily access departure information via screens and announcements during your wait. The station does not have facilities like luggage storage or toilets, though it does offer CCTV security throughout the premises for your safety.

Accessibility and Connectivity

Designed with inclusivity in mind, Kintbury provides step-free access across most parts of the station with a level crossing connection between platforms. A word of caution, though: the access ramps can be steep. There are no ticket barriers, and waiting room facilities are minimal, but seating areas are available for your comfort.

For drivers, the station is served by a parking area managed by APCOA Parking, offering 12 spaces and free parking to ease your journey. Bicycle storage is available too, with stands accommodating up to eight bicycles, equipped with CCTV for added security.

Station Facilities and Amenities

As a traveler, you expect convenience and accessibility, and Horwich Parkway delivers on both fronts. The ticket office is open from 06:20 to 19:35 on weekdays and Saturdays, with ticket machines available 24/7 for those purchasing or collecting pre-booked tickets. Smartcards can be issued and validated here, offering a modern, efficient travel experience.

Accessibility is a priority, with step-free access across the station and tactile paving for visually impaired passengers. While the station lacks waiting rooms and refreshment facilities, it compensates with ample seating areas and accessible services such as induction loops and ramps for train access. Plus, with 250 car parking spaces, including 12 accessible spots, and cycle stands available, it's easy to accommodate all forms of arrival.

Connectivity and Transport Links

Horwich Parkway is more than just a station; it's a gateway. With local buses to destinations like Horwich and Leigh conveniently stationed opposite the entrance, you're well-connected to the surrounding areas (Busline: 0871 200 2233).
